Discover Live Network NetBrain s discovery engine uses a complex algorithm to walk through the network hop-by-hop, starting from the seed router. To achieve the best accuracy and speed, make sure: All login credentials for telnet/ssh and SNMP strings are specified The Network Server has SNMP access to the network devices Protocols like CDP/LLDP/FDP are turned on Launch network discovery from Workstation s Start Page. Click the button to enter telnet/ssh login credentials and SNMP strings. Explore other discovery options to fine tune the discovery of fragmented networks. Visual Search Use the Visual Search function to access the vast amount of network information inside NetBrain. Besides many drill-down capabilities, users can create a dynamic map instantly simply by mousing over a matched entry. Dynamic Network Mapping A Dynamic Map is a data-driven map that can be created instantly with point-and-click. The network data collected during the discovery provides the backend data for the mapping process. Once created, NetBrain can automatically update the map based on live data collected from the network. Click the New map button to create an empty map Drag a device entry from pane and drop it into the map Click the red sign of the device to launch the neighbor dialog. Select a few neighbors to be extended and press enter Refer to online training materials to learn about many other ways to create dynamic map: Map traceroute output Map routing table Map data center Map VLAN Scroll the wheel of the mouse to zoom in to the dynamic map. Automate Network Documentation Leveraging the data model behind dynamic map, users can create traditional network documents such as Visio diagrams, design assessment document or inventory report in one-click. During this process, dynamic map serves as a special media to define the scope of documentation. The following dynamic maps are often used: Map of device group after dynamic search Map of VLAN Map of L2 Switch Group Map of devices defined by a set of configuration files Map of traffic flow Build a dynamic Qmap interactively with one of the automation methods provided by NetBrain. From the Qmap floating menu, click the button then select Visio Map to create a Visio diagram From the Qmap floating menu, click the button then select Word Document to build a network design document in Word format. Map-Driven Change Management (Add-On Module) NetBrain s change management workflow is an integrated solution that makes network changes more efficient and less risky. You can: Define network changes with the map Automatically push configurations to selected devices Analyze the impact of changes automatically Document the results with one-click From an open Qmap, click Run from the map floating menu, then click Define Network Change to create a CM task. Define Network Change Task Click Summary button to switch to Summary view, annotate the CM Task here. Click Define Network Change button to switch to Define Network Change view, define configlet/rollback config which need to be issued. Click Benchmark Before/After button to switch to corresponding view, define show commands which can reveal the differences. Implement Network Change Task Switch to Benchmark Before view, click Run CLI Commands button to perform a benchmark before chagne. Click Execute button to switch to Execute view, click button to push predefined configlet to network devices. Switch to Benchmark After view, click Run CLI Commands button to perform a benchmark after change. Verify Network Change Results Click Compare button to switch to Compare view, Select two Benchmark DataFolders to verify Network Change results. Analyze Network Design Dynamic map can be used not only to illustrate network topology, but also to analyze and view network design, such as routing, VRF, Multicasting, VLAN and Spanningtree. From the floating menu of any L3 or L2 map, From within a L3 map, click the menu Highlight > Routing Protocol to visualize routing design across all devices in the map From within a L2 map, click the menu Highlight > VLAN or Spanning-Tree to visualize the VLAN assignment and Spanning-Tree status Launch Design Reader by clicking the button off the home ribbon menu.
